About Roland Prielhofer

Roland Prielhofer is a scholar working on Molecular Biology, Biotechnology and Biomedical Engineering, having authored 13 papers that have together received 744 indexed citations. Recurring topics across this work include Fungal and yeast genetics research (10 papers), Microbial Metabolic Engineering and Bioproduction (8 papers) and Viral Infectious Diseases and Gene Expression in Insects (7 papers). The work is most often cited by research in Aging (20 citations), Molecular Biology (682 citations) and Biotechnology (85 citations). Roland Prielhofer has collaborated with scholars based in Austria, Switzerland and United Kingdom. Frequent co-authors include Diethard Mattanovich, Brigitte Gasser, Michael Maurer, Michael Sauer, Hans Marx, Matthias G. Steiger, Thomas Gassler, Christoph Kiziak, Verena Puxbaum and Richard J. Zahrl. Their work appears in journals such as Nucleic Acids Research, Biotechnology and Bioengineering and BMC Genomics.
